Monthly Cost of Living
🙂A single person spends $545 per month in El Kef vs $614 in Sfax, rent included.
🙂A couple spends around $876 per month in El Kef vs $998 in Sfax, rent included.
🙂A family of three spends $1,208 per month in El Kef vs $1,382 in Sfax, rent included.
🙂El Kef is about 11% cheaper than Sfax, driven mainly by Clothing & Footwear.
📊Both El Kef and Sfax are more affordable than the global median – El Kef59% lower, Sfax54% lower.

Cost Breakdown
🏠A central one-bedroom costs $198 in El Kef versus $187 in Sfax.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.
💰Salaries run about 89% higher in Sfax, which partly offsets the higher cost of living there. Purchasing power depends on which expenses matter most to you.
🛒A mid-range dinner for two costs $13.00 in El Kef versus $21.00 in Sfax.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$172 vs $190 – making El Kef the more affordable choice for daily food spending.
